Plectranthus ambiguus, commonly known as the "Swedish Ivy," is a captivating perennial plant native to South Africa. With its lush, green foliage and trailing growth habit, it makes an excellent choice for both indoor and outdoor gardens. This versatile plant thrives in various conditions, making it a favorite among gardeners and plant enthusiasts alike.
What sets Plectranthus ambiguus apart is its ability to adapt to different environments while providing a stunning visual appeal. Its aromatic leaves release a pleasant scent when brushed against, adding an extra sensory experience to your garden. This plant is not only beautiful but also serves as a natural air purifier, enhancing the quality of your indoor spaces.
One of the special features of Plectranthus ambiguus is its resilience. It can tolerate low light conditions and is drought-resistant, making it an ideal choice for busy individuals or those new to gardening. Additionally, its ability to attract pollinators like bees and butterflies contributes positively to the ecosystem.
If you think caring for Plectranthus ambiguus is like raising a teenager, think again! This plant thrives on a little love and attention, but it’s not too needy. Just provide it with well-draining soil, moderate watering, and a sprinkle of fertilizer during the growing season. It’s like giving your plant a spa day without the hefty price tag.
This plant isn’t just a pretty face; it’s a multitasker! Plectranthus ambiguus can purify the air, making your home feel fresher than a morning breeze. Plus, it’s known for its pest-repelling properties. Who knew a plant could be your personal bodyguard against pesky insects?
Want to expand your plant family? Propagating Plectranthus ambiguus is as easy as pie! Just take a cutting, pop it in water, and watch it grow roots like a pro. It’s like giving your plant a chance to make new friends without the awkward small talk.
This plant is a bit of a diva when it comes to sunlight. It prefers bright, indirect light, so don’t go throwing it into the spotlight like a contestant on a talent show. Too much direct sun can lead to crispy leaves, and nobody wants that!
Watering Plectranthus ambiguus is like finding the perfect balance in a relationship. Too much water, and you’ll drown it; too little, and it’ll feel neglected. Aim for a happy medium, allowing the top inch of soil to dry out between waterings.
While Plectranthus ambiguus is generally pest-resistant, it’s not immune to the occasional uninvited guest. Keep an eye out for aphids and spider mites, who think they can crash the party. A little neem oil or insecticidal soap can send them packing faster than a bad date.
This plant has a taste for well-draining soil, much like a connoisseur at a wine tasting. A mix of potting soil and perlite or sand will do the trick, ensuring your plant doesn’t feel like it’s stuck in quicksand.
Plectranthus ambiguus prefers a cozy environment, much like a cat lounging in a sunbeam. Ideal temperatures range from 60°F to 75°F. Anything colder, and it might start to shiver like it just walked into a freezer.
Pruning this plant is like giving it a stylish haircut. Regular trimming encourages bushier growth and keeps it looking sharp. Just snip away the leggy stems, and your plant will thank you by flaunting its new look.
Whether you choose to keep Plectranthus ambiguus indoors or outdoors, it’s a versatile gem. Indoors, it can brighten up your living space, while outdoors, it can add a splash of color to your garden. Just make sure it’s not too exposed to harsh elements!
Good news for pet lovers! Plectranthus ambiguus is non-toxic to cats and dogs, so you can let your furry friends roam freely without worrying about them nibbling on your plant. It’s like having a plant that’s a safe haven in a world of toxic greenery.
This plant isn’t just for show; it has a variety of uses! From ornamental purposes to traditional medicine in some cultures, Plectranthus ambiguus is a jack-of-all-trades. It’s like the Swiss Army knife of the plant world, ready to serve in multiple roles!
